Racing Incident Report

Whilst in the saddling stalls, FORTUNE STAR had its left front plate refitted. FORTUNE STAR was examined by the Veterinary Officer who said in his opinion it was suitable to race. On arrival at the barriers, the tongue tie fitted to REGENCY CHAMPION was replaced. Despite being ridden along in the early stages, TRAVEL GUIDE failed to muster speed. Near the 1100 Metres, THUNDER FLYER (Z Purton), which was racing ungenerously, was checked away from the heels of SUPER BROTHER which, after initially shifting in and away from BEAR ELITE (C W Wong), was taken in by that horse for a short distance. In this incident, UNDOUBTEDLY MINE, which was racing inside of THUNDER FLYER, became unbalanced when bumped by that horse. C W Wong was reprimanded and advised to ensure that he is sufficiently clear when shifting ground in similar circumstances. Having in mind the evidence provided by Z Purton in respect of the racing manners of THUNDER FLYER in this race, the Stewards ruled that prior to being permitted to race again, THUNDER FLYER must barrier trial satisfactorily on two consecutive occasions around a bend and must be ridden by a senior rider. Passing the 900 Metres, KIDCONI, which was proving difficult to settle, got its head up when being checked away from the heels of REGENCY CHAMPION which was being steadied to allow BEAR ELITE to cross. SPECTACULAR AWARD, which was following, was hampered in consequence. Making the first turn near the 850 Metres, THUNDER FLYER raced greenly, got it head on the side and shifted out. After the 400 Metres, SUPER BROTHER got its head on the side and hung in. Throughout the race, MR AWARD and FORTUNE STAR travelled wide and without cover. After the race, B Prebble stated that, in his opinion, BRILLIANT WORLD did not stretch out and was uncomfortable in its action. A veterinary inspection of BRILLIANT WORLD after the race did not show any significant findings. Before being allowed to race again, BRILLIANT WORLD will be subjected to an official veterinary examination. When questioned regarding the disappointing performance of UNDOUBTEDLY MINE, T Clark stated that it had been hoped that the horse would be able to obtain a forward position. He said UNDOUBTEDLY MINE did not show any early speed and then raced tight near the 1100 Metres. He added this resulted in the horse racing further back than had been intended. He said UNDOUBTEDLY MINE travelled only fairly throughout the race and came under pressure prior to the Home Turn. He said UNDOUBTEDLY MINE did not initially respond to his riding, however, over the concluding stages made up some ground, but still finished off the race only fairly. A veterinary inspection of UNDOUBTEDLY MINE after the race did not show any significant findings. A veterinary inspection of HAPPY DRUMMING after the race revealed the horse to be lame in the right front leg. Before being allowed to race again, HAPPY DRUMMING will be subjected to an official veterinary examination. After the race, an endoscopic examination was conducted on THUNDER FLYER at the request of Trainer K W Lui. The Veterinary Surgeon said this examination showed a substantial amount of mucopus in the horse's trachea. Also after the race, an endoscopic examination was conducted on KIDCONI at the request of Trainer C W Chang. The Veterinary Surgeon said this examination showed a substantial amount of blood in the horse's trachea. Before being allowed to race again, KIDCONI will be subjected to an official veterinary examination. REGENCY CHAMPION and BEAR ELITE were sent for sampling.
